Summer is here and the government is worrying about riots on the streets. In their final episode of this political term, Beth, Ruth and Harriet unpack No 10's briefing this week that Angela Rayner has warned about the risk of civil unrest, almost a year on from the murders in Southport that sparked a summer of violent protests.
So what is the government's strategy? And what's really going on in towns like Epping, where asylum hotels have sparked backlash this week?
Plus, the return of Sir James Cleverley to the Tory front bench: is this the start of a Conservative revival or just more reshuffling?
